Page MenuHomePhorge

README.md
No OneTemporary

Authored By
Unknown
Size
897 B
Referenced Files
None
Subscribers
None

README.md

# Overview
Kolab is deployed in a two node K3S cluster, using local storage on the nodes (no shared storage required).
All data is replicated from the primary to the secondary node via drbd, and it is possible to fail over to the secondary node if the primary is lost.
All external connections are going through HA-Proxy with ip failover via keepalived, so failing over is transparent externally.
Some load-balancing can be achieved by using services on both nodes, but to have high-availability, a single node must be able to handle the complete load.
Both mariadb and HA-Proxy are run outside of k3s for this deployment.
This deployment is more complex in that not all components can be run in k3s, and workloads need to be explicitly assigned to nodes,
but it allows to achieve redundancy and a limited amount of load-balancing with minimal resources (only two nodes, using local disks).

File Metadata

Mime Type
text/plain
Expires
Fri, Apr 24, 11:03 AM (1 w, 4 d ago)
Storage Engine
blob
Storage Format
Raw Data
Storage Handle
18734403
Default Alt Text
README.md (897 B)

Event Timeline